# Offline mode setup for the Bramblewick survey client.
# New folks: when a surveyor loses signal out in the Dunmore flats,
# the app queues observations in a local store and syncs once the
# Cairnhop gateway is reachable again. Don't disable the queue —
# that's how we lost a week of wetland data last spring.
# The sync worker still needs to authenticate against Cairnhop even
# for deferred uploads, so the key below gets baked into the config.
# The internal service key for the sync worker is appended here.

gateway credential: kto7_GoY89Me

Subject: Revised commission scheme — quick read

Hi all,

The new commission model for the Braylor product family kicks in next quarter: flat 4% base, accelerators above 110% of target, and no more clawback on returns under thirty days. Tamsin's team modelled it against last year's numbers and payouts stay roughly neutral. Full deck Friday. One thing to keep strictly within this group follows below.

management briefing: Jorixax Holdings is in early talks to buy Casixax Holdings for about $420.3 million. The Fenmir launch date is October 27, and nothing goes to the press before then. Legal wants the Keloxek Foods term sheet redrafted before April 16.

## svc-spoolpress

The Spoolpress microservice queues print jobs from Deskline clients and dispatches them to floor printers. Runs under the `svc-spoolpress` account with queue read/write only. Restart via the Ops console if jobs pile up. Logs go to Tracebin. Config lives in the deploy repo. The service authenticates with the key shown below.

API key for yahig-tadup: kto7_ubizbYm

Leadership Review Briefing — Heads of Department

The review will decide whether to expand the Grelford plant or shift overflow to the Mossvale contract facility. Expansion costs more upfront but protects margin and quality control; contracting out is faster but adds logistics complexity. Demand forecasts from the Pellant line support either path at current growth rates. Department heads should bring staffing and capex implications to the session. The recommendation under consideration is summarized below.

board note of bajop-yaweg: The western region missed its Pelys quota by 58.0 percent last quarter. Pelysek Foods plans to raise the Belius list price by 44.0 percent in July. The steering committee signed off on a budget of $133.8 million for Project Pelax. The renewal with Zoraelix Systems closes at $61.9 million a year, 12.7 percent above the last contract.